Pre-Vetting Commission resumes the evaluation process of judge Marina Rusu, following the decision of the Supreme Court of Justice

The Evaluation Commission for assessing the integrity of candidates for the position of member in the self-administration bodies of judges and prosecutors (Pre-Vetting Commission) announces the launch of the resumed evaluation of judge Marina Rusu, candidate for membership in the Superior Council of Magistracy (SCM), after the Supreme Court of Justice (SJC) upheld the appeal of candidate by its decision of 29 January 2024.

The Pre-Vetting Commission has notified today the candidate Marina Rusu about the launch of the resumed evaluation, based on Article 14 paragraph (10) of Law No. 26/2022 and the SCJ conclusions.

After the issuance of the SCJ decisions of 1 August 2023 and 29 January 2024 ordering the re-evaluation of 22 candidates for membership in the Superior Council of Magistracy or the Superior Council of Prosecutors, so far, the Pre-Vetting Commission has finalised/terminated the re-evaluation of 10 candidates.
